Synchronization Procedure

- Plug the motor/actuator into the harness and provide power until the motor/actuator stops in the vent position. If the motor does not operate when powered, then the motor is already in the vent position.
- If the sunroof window is in the closed position, remove the sunroof window. Refer to Sunroof Window Replacement .
- Verify that the sunroof guide mechanisms are fully forward and in the vent position.
- Install the sunroof motor/actuator. Refer to Sunroof Motor/Actuator Replacement .
- Install the sunroof window, if necessary. Refer to Sunroof Window Replacement .
- Operate the sunroof to verify proper operation.
IMPORTANT:
Verify that both the sunroof motor/actuator and the sunroof guide mechanisms are in the vent position before you begin the synchronization procedure.
